Buccaneers Rookie WR Mike Evans Out 2-3 Weeks With Groin Injury

Mike Garafolo of Fox Sports is reporting that Buccaneers rookie WR Mike Evans will miss the next 2-3 weeks with a groin strain he suffered during Sunday’s win over the Steelers.

  • Garafolo points out that the Bucs have their bye week coming up in three weeks.
  • Ian Rapoport has confirmed that Evans’ timetable is 2-3 weeks.

“Just a little tweak — it hurt, and I couldn’t run,” Evans said of his injury after Sunday’s game, via the Tampa Bay Times.

The Buccaneers got a solid performance from Louis Murphy, who just recently signed to a contract. Tampa Bay is likely to rely on Murphy and Robert Herron against the Saints next weekend.

On the season, Evans has caught 17 passes for 203 yards and a touchdown.
